Abstract:
Higher engineering education in the new era undertakes the important task of training engineering talents with knowledge updating ability, position adaptation ability and career expansion ability. It is the top priority to construct a characteristic talent training system based on multi- dimensional training quality evaluation. This paper sorts out the relevant progress of engineering talent training at home and abroad, analyzes the evaluation elements of talent training quality, designs the evaluation index system of talent training quality combining quantitative evaluation and qualitative evaluation, and establishes the continuous improvement mechanism. On the basis of the evaluation and improvement, the automation major constructs a course system with electric power characteristic, which focuses on students' ability training and meets the engineering education certification standards. Meanwhile, the theory and practice curriculum are improved and the mapping relationship between curriculum and the students' ability training is clarified, thus achieving the teaching layout to cultivate the ability of 'solving complex engineering problems'. Taking the automation major in North China Electric Power University as an example, this paper introduces the practical results of the reform, hoping to provide reference for the training of engineering talent with industry characteristics.
